I have consulted the documentation and it seems that the fromisoformat method changed in Python 3.11. It was my fault for not checking the changes made to that method. pip-rating should support all versions of Python from 3.8 to 3.12, but I have not correctly tested that method.
https://docs.python.org/3.11/library/datetime.html?highlight=fromisoformat#datetime.datetime.fromisoformat

My suggestion is a condition that checks the Python version. If the version is 3.11 or higher, fromisoformat should be used. If it is 3.10 or lower, the strptime method (with several possible formats) or dateutil should be used. The behavior of the latter condition should be the same as fromisoformat. In the future, when the minimum version is Python 3.11, the condition for Python 3.10 version can be removed.

I agree to create a file utils.py to include the new function parse_iso_datetime, it's a good idea. The code looks good, I would only add a logger to this code:

from logging import getLogger

logger = getLogger(__name__)

def get_score(self, package_rating: "PackageRating") -> ScoreValue:
    ...
    try:
        dt = parse_iso_datetime(iso_dt)
    except ValueError:
        logger.warning("Invalid datetime received for package %s: %s", package_rating.package.name, iso_dt)
        return ScoreValue(0)

The code should not fail if it receives an unsupported date, but it should not fail silently either. Otherwise, it will be difficult to detect and fix the error if the date format changes in the future.

If you can, include or modify the existing tests to check the modification. It would be great if you could reproduce the bug in a test and then fix it. If not, don't worry, I can take care of the tests. The code should have types. If you have any questions, just let me know.
